On Monday I have to rip down a LIKE NEW 01 CBR600 I think it has about 2500 Miles on it :) But it was a repo from like 5 years ago and they just want to part it out..

Soo... Any insight on the best way to break it down for ebay? I mainly wounder about the plastics. Should I sell them together as a set or appart? What about other high ticket items that would sell better removed from another part... I noticed on ebay that some front (headlight farings) sell for over $300 without the lamp assy. and the lamp assy will sell for about $300. but I see whole sets of plastics w/ the light assy for $600 ???

You'll get the most money if you part out everything individually.  However, it's a lot easier to find buyers who will pick up assemblies.  Me, for example, if I'm looking for a set of forks and want to pay $300, I won't heasitate to pay $450 for a complete front end.  Stuff like that.

Big ticket items are going to be forks, front wheel, frame, fairings, radiator, and the engine.  All the rest you'll be able to pick up $10 or $15 from time to time but don't let your expectations run rampant.
